Diffuse decrease in hair density secondary to rapid conversion of anagen to telogen hair. Precipitated by stressful events, illness, fever, pregnancy, crash diet, medications; hair can be shed 2-6 mo after precipitant.

Physical: Diffuse hair loss; positive hair pull test (>10% club hairs).

Investigations: CBC, ferritin, TSH; punch biopsy if unsure.

DDx: Alopecia areata, anagen effluvium, androgenetic alopecia.

Management

Reassurance. Wait for regrowth, and treat any underlying cause. Topical minoxidil may be beneficial.
